Understanding the Foreclosure Process in Atlanta GA: What You Need to Know

Foreclosure in Georgia can be a complicated and distressing process, especially if you’re already struggling to make your mortgage payments. In Georgia, the foreclosure process begins after you miss several payments, and the bank typically starts by sending you a Notice of Default. From there, they will set a date for the foreclosure auction, usually within 60 days after the notice is sent. For homeowners who are behind on payments, it can feel like time is running out.

If you’re facing foreclosure, the clock is ticking. You may be wondering if selling your house is the best option, or if there are ways to avoid foreclosure altogether. One of the most appealing aspects of selling your home before the foreclosure process is completed is that it can help you avoid a foreclosure on your credit report, which can have long-term consequences. A foreclosure can lower your credit score by as much as 200 points, making it difficult to secure future loans, rent a home, or even get a job. By selling your house in foreclosure, you can prevent this damage.

Selling a House in Foreclosure vs. Fighting Foreclosure: What’s the Best Option for You?

When you’re facing foreclosure, you have a few options. You can try to negotiate with the lender for a loan modification, go through a foreclosure defense, or sell your home. Each option has its benefits and drawbacks, and the best solution depends on your financial situation and how quickly you need to act.

Fighting foreclosure can be a lengthy and complex process. It may involve negotiating with your lender for a loan modification or filing legal challenges. While this might work for some homeowners, it can take months, and the longer you wait, the more damage it could do to your credit. Additionally, not all loan modifications are approved, leaving you with a house you can’t afford and little time to figure out another solution.

On the other hand, selling your house in foreclosure offers a more immediate resolution. By selling your house quickly, especially to a cash buyer, you can avoid the auction, stop foreclosure in its tracks, and prevent further damage to your credit. Cash buyers can often close within a week, allowing you to walk away without the stress and uncertainty of an auction.

Costs of Selling a Foreclosed House in Atlanta

One major concern when selling a house in foreclosure is the cost. You may be wondering how much it will cost to sell your house in this situation, and if there are any hidden fees that you need to worry about. The truth is that selling a house in foreclosure is much more affordable when you sell to a cash buyer, compared to selling through traditional real estate agents.

Traditional real estate sales typically require that you pay agent commissions, closing costs, and may even involve costly repairs and staging fees to make your home marketable. In addition, you might not be able to sell your house quickly enough to avoid foreclosure if you go through the traditional route. Typically, it could take several months to close a sale, and the longer your home sits on the market, the more likely it is that your foreclosure date will arrive before you can sell.

When you sell for cash to a home buyer, you can bypass these costs. Most reputable cash buyers cover the closing costs, take your house in “as-is” condition, and close quickly without any commissions or fees. This means you can pocket more of the sale price and avoid the financial strain that other methods may add.

For example, let’s say you owe $200,000 on your mortgage and you sell your home for $180,000 to a cash buyer. If you were selling through traditional methods, you’d still need to pay agent commissions (around 6%), closing costs (about 3%), and possibly thousands of dollars in repairs. In contrast, a cash sale could save you these costs, making it a much better financial option when you’re in foreclosure.
